Illumination Strategies for Shorter Days
By late December, the sunlight establishes fairly very early in Brunswick, leaving us with long hours of synthetic light. This transition dramatically impacts just how your furniture looks and exactly how the area really feels. Relying only on overhead lighting can make a large sofa appearance level and unappealing. To battle this, smart house owners utilize split lighting. This entails placing lamps at varying heights to produce pockets of warmth and darkness.
Flooring lights with warm-toned light bulbs can cast a gentle glow over the edge of a sectional, making it the perfect spot for late-night tea. Little table lamps on side tables assist define the limits of the seating location. During the 2026 winter, we see an approach matte surfaces and ceramic bases for light. These materials do not mirror the rough glow of light, instead diffusing it softly throughout the space. This method guarantees that your primary seating remains the focal point of the area even after the sunlight goes away behind the Lake Erie clouds. Incorporating Local Greenery and Scents
Bringing life right into a winter season home frequently includes greenery. While the gardens outside are inactive, indoor plants can love the best treatment. Large-leafed plants like fiddled-leaf figs or rubber trees add a vivid pop of color against neutral furniture. If you discover upkeep challenging throughout the dark months, top quality dried botanicals are a significant trend for 2026. Dried eucalyptus or pampas yard organized in hefty stone vases adds a building component to the area without requiring a green thumb.
The fragrance of a home additionally contributes to its overall style. Wintertime in Ohio is identified with the smell of woodsmoke and pine. Using soy-based candle lights or vital oil diffusers with notes of cedar, sandalwood, or spiced citrus can complete the sensory experience of a well-styled area.
